Why move from Synapse to Fabric, and when
Microsoft Fabric folds data engineering, warehousing, real-time analytics, and Power BI into a single SaaS platform, with every workload reading and writing the same Delta tables in OneLake. That removes the copies and hand-offs that pile up in a Synapse plus Power BI estate. Direct Lake is the payoff most teams feel first: Power BI reads Lakehouse and Warehouse tables directly, so you drop the import refresh windows and the memory ceilings that come with them.
Timing matters too. The Power BI Premium to Fabric transition is time boxed: Premium capacity (the P SKUs) is being replaced by Fabric capacity (the F SKUs), and teams still on Premium face a real deadline rather than an open-ended choice. Moving to Fabric on your own schedule, with a plan, beats being pushed into a rushed capacity swap. What actually changes
The migration is not a rename. Each Synapse component maps to a Fabric equivalent, and the connections and storage paths change because data now lands in OneLake:
- Dedicated SQL pools move to the Fabric Warehouse and the Lakehouse SQL endpoint. The T-SQL surface is familiar, but tables live as Delta in OneLake and distribution and indexing assumptions are revisited.
- Synapse pipelines move to Fabric Data Factory pipelines. The orchestration patterns carry over, while linked services and datasets are rebuilt against Fabric connections.
- Synapse Spark notebooks and jobs move to Fabric Spark, writing to Lakehouse Delta tables instead of dedicated storage accounts.
- Workspaces and capacity consolidate: Synapse workspaces and Power BI Premium capacity are replaced by Fabric workspaces on F SKU capacity, with a single governance and security model.
Underneath all of it, the storage layer shifts to OneLake, which is why our data engineering work focuses on getting the lakehouse structure and Delta tables right before anything reads from them.
How we run the migration
We treat a Synapse to Fabric migration as a rebuild on a governed foundation, not a one-for-one copy of every object. The method is concrete:
- Full inventory. We catalogue every report, dataset, SQL pool, pipeline, notebook, and data source in the existing estate so nothing is discovered mid-cutover.
- Dependency mapping. We trace what feeds what, from source system through pipeline and model to the report a user opens, so we migrate in the right order.
- Rebuild on a governed semantic model. Reports are rebuilt on a governed Power BI semantic model with one definition per KPI, rather than copying forward duplicated and conflicting measures.
- Phased, wave-by-wave cutover. We migrate in waves, validating parity at each step so the numbers on Fabric match the numbers on Synapse before a workload is trusted.
- No information blackout. Coexistence keeps the current platform serving the business until each new path is confirmed, so reporting never goes dark.
- Your own tenant. Everything is built in your Microsoft tenant, on your capacity, with your governance, so you own the result outright.

Coexistence during the transition
The riskiest part of any platform migration is the gap between old and new. We remove it with a deliberate coexistence period: OneLake shortcuts let Fabric read the data your Synapse workspace already owns, so pipelines and reports run against a single source while we migrate around them. Old and new paths run side by side, each workload is cut over only after parity is confirmed, and the Synapse equivalent stays available until its Fabric replacement has earned trust.
